In today's Ming Dynasty, there is a special policy, that is, when the Cao transport ship returns empty, it is allowed to load commodities.
This policy is still very good, there are two benefits, the first is not to waste hundreds of thousands of tons of capacity when the ship returns, and to promote the circulation of goods between the north and the south.
The second is that the Cao army in charge of Cao Yun is too hard, so he can give the Cao army a certain subsidy in this way, without increasing the expenses of the imperial court.

In fact, Zheng Zhiyan's idea cannot be mistaken from the perspective of a big salt merchant. There is a phenomenon of land annexation, as well as in the salt industry.
To give another example of time and space, why did the great salt merchants of the Qing Dynasty seem to be ten or dozens of times richer than the salt merchants of the Ming Dynasty?
In addition to factors such as population and production increase, the biggest reason is that the salt industry developed into a monopoly in the Qing Dynasty.
In the late Ming Dynasty, there were 1,200 salt merchants in Yangzhou, but in the middle of the Qing Dynasty, Yangzhou salt merchants were monopolized by the 24 general merchants, and all other small and medium-sized salt merchants were dependent on these 24 general merchants.
